数据库备份为脚本的益处解析
数据库备份成脚本的好处

首页 2025-03-30 09:33:49



数据库备份成脚本的好处:构建数据安全的坚固防线 在信息化高速发展的今天,数据已成为企业最宝贵的资产之一

    无论是金融、医疗、教育还是零售等行业,数据的完整性、可用性和安全性都是企业持续运营和竞争力提升的关键

    而数据库备份,作为数据保护的核心策略,其重要性不言而喻

    在众多备份方式中,将数据库备份成脚本(Script-Based Backup)的做法,因其灵活性、可控性和高效性,逐渐成为众多企业和开发者的首选

    本文将深入探讨数据库备份成脚本的诸多好处,以期为企业构建一道坚实的数据安全防线

     一、灵活性与可定制性 数据库备份脚本的最大优势在于其高度的灵活性和可定制性

    通过编写脚本,企业可以根据自身业务需求,精确控制备份的时间、频率、范围以及存储位置

    例如,对于某些关键业务数据,可以实现实时或近实时备份;而对于变化不频繁的历史数据,则可以设定较低的备份频率,以节省存储资源和备份时间

     此外,脚本还允许自定义备份策略,如全量备份与增量备份的结合使用

    全量备份能够确保数据的完整性,但会占用较多资源;增量备份则只备份自上次备份以来发生变化的数据,效率更高

    通过脚本灵活安排这两种备份方式,可以在保证数据安全的同时,优化资源利用

     二、自动化与效率提升 将数据库备份过程脚本化,是实现备份自动化的关键步骤

    一旦脚本编写完成并测试无误,就可以利用操作系统的计划任务(如Cron作业、Windows任务计划程序)或第三方调度工具,实现备份任务的定时自动执行

    这不仅大大减轻了IT人员的工作负担,减少了人为错误的可能性,还确保了备份的及时性和连续性

     自动化备份还意味着在数据库规模扩大或结构变化时,只需调整脚本即可适应新的备份需求,无需重新配置整个备份系统,提高了运维效率

    同时,脚本备份通常支持并行处理,能够同时处理多个数据库或表的备份任务,进一步缩短了备份周期

     三、恢复速度与灾难恢复能力 备份的最终目的是在数据丢失或损坏时能够迅速恢复

    数据库备份脚本通常包含详细的恢复步骤,使得数据恢复过程更加直观、快捷

    与依赖于图形界面的备份工具相比,脚本恢复不需要额外的软件安装或配置,只需在目标环境中执行相应的恢复命令即可,这在紧急情况下尤为重要

     此外,脚本备份易于复制和分发,便于在异地建立灾难恢复站点

    通过将备份脚本和备份数据同步至远程服务器,企业可以在主数据中心遭遇自然灾害、硬件故障等不可抗力时,迅速切换到备份数据中心,保证业务连续性

    这种跨地域的数据冗余策略,显著增强了企业的灾难恢复能力

     四、成本效益与资源优化 从成本角度来看,数据库备份脚本是一种经济高效的解决方案

    相较于商业备份软件,脚本备份无需支付高昂的许可费用,降低了企业的IT支出

    同时,由于脚本可以根据实际需求精确控制备份范围和频率,避免了不必要的资源浪费,特别是在处理大规模数据库时,这种优势更为明显

     资源优化还体现在对存储空间的有效利用上

    通过实施增量备份和差异备份策略,脚本备份能够显著减少重复数据的存储,延长现有存储设备的使用寿命,或允许企业在不增加硬件投资的情况下,处理更多的备份数据

     五、透明性与审计追踪 数据库备份脚本通常包含详细的日志记录功能,能够记录每次备份的开始时间、结束时间、备份类型、数据量以及任何可能的错误信息

    这些日志对于监控备份任务的执行状态、诊断问题以及进行事后审计至关重要

     透明化的备份过程增强了企业的内部管理能力,确保IT团队能够及时了解备份系统的健康状况,采取必要的维护措施

    同时,详细的审计追踪记录也为符合行业监管要求、应对合规性检查提供了有力支持

     六、技术独立性与兼容性 脚本备份的一个不可忽视的优势是其技术独立性和广泛的兼容性

    无论是关系型数据库(如MySQL、PostgreSQL、Oracle)还是NoSQL数据库(如MongoDB、Cassandra),只要支持SQL命令或通过API访问,都可以通过编写相应的脚本来实现备份

    这种技术上的中立性,使得企业在选择或更换数据库系统时,无需担心备份方案的兼容性问题,保护了投资的长期价值

     结语 综上所述,数据库备份成脚本以其灵活性、自动化、高效恢复、成本效益、透明性和技术兼容性等多重优势,成为构建数据安全防线的关键策略

    它不仅满足了企业对数据安全的基本需求,更为企业在数字化转型的道路上提供了强有力的支撑

    随着技术的不断进步和业务需求的日益复杂,持续优化备份脚本,结合最新的加密技术、云存储解决方案以及人工智能辅助的监控与分析,将进一步提升数据备份的效率和安全性,为企业的长远发展保驾护航

    在数据为王的时代,重视并投资于数据库备份脚本的建设,无疑是每一个智慧企业的明智之选

    

MySQL连接就这么简单!本地远程、编程语言连接方法一网打尽
还在为MySQL日期计算头疼?这份加一天操作指南能解决90%问题
MySQL日志到底在哪里?Linux/Windows/macOS全平台查找方法在此
MySQL数据库管理工具全景评测:从Workbench到DBeaver的技术选型指南
MySQL密码忘了怎么办?这份重置指南能救急,Windows/Linux/Mac都适用
你的MySQL为什么经常卡死?可能是锁表在作怪!快速排查方法在此
MySQL单表卡爆怎么办?从策略到实战,一文掌握「分表」救命技巧
清空MySQL数据表千万别用错!DELETE和TRUNCATE这个区别可能导致重大事故
你的MySQL中文排序一团糟?记住这几点,轻松实现准确拼音排序!
别再混淆Hive和MySQL了!读懂它们的天壤之别,才算摸到大数据的门道